Key concepts and overview

Source of funds requests are designed to ensure that the money being used for gambling is obtained legally and ethically. This process involves verifying the origin of the funds a player intends to use for betting or gaming activities. In Canada, regulatory bodies have instituted these measures to combat money laundering and promote responsible gambling. The core idea is to protect both the players and the integrity of the gaming industry. However, while these measures are essential for maintaining a safe gambling environment, they can also introduce significant delays in the withdrawal process.

Main features and details

The source of funds verification process typically involves several steps. First, players are required to submit documentation that proves the legitimacy of their funds. This can include bank statements, pay stubs, or tax returns. Once submitted, the gaming operator must review these documents to ensure they meet regulatory standards. This review process can take anywhere from a few hours to several days, depending on the operator’s efficiency and the volume of requests they are handling.

Practical examples and use cases

Consider a scenario where a player wins a significant amount while playing online poker. Eager to withdraw their winnings, they submit a request only to be met with a request for source of funds verification. The player provides their bank statements and proof of income, but due to high demand, the operator takes longer than expected to process the documents. As a result, the player experiences frustration and dissatisfaction, which could lead them to reconsider their choice of gaming platform.

Another example involves a player who has recently changed jobs and is unable to provide consistent documentation of their income. This situation can complicate the verification process, leading to further delays in withdrawals. Such scenarios highlight the importance of a streamlined SOF verification process to enhance the overall user experience.

Additional insights

Industry analysts should also consider edge cases where players may face unique challenges during the SOF verification process. For instance, players who engage in cryptocurrency transactions may find it difficult to provide traditional documentation, leading to further complications. Additionally, operators should be aware of the importance of clear communication with players regarding the SOF process. Providing detailed guidance on what documents are required and how long the verification process typically takes can help manage player expectations and reduce frustration.

Expert tips for operators include investing in technology that can streamline the verification process, such as automated document verification systems. These systems can significantly reduce the time required for processing SOF requests, thereby enhancing the overall efficiency of withdrawal transactions.
